why the auxilary(starting)winding is provided in single
phase inductoin motor?
Answers were Sorted based on User's Feedback
Answer / ashokreddyreguri
single phase supply given to single phase IM (having only
one wdg)produces only alternating flux which can only
induce emf but cannot make the rotor rotate.Auxiliary wdg
is provided to split the phase.so the motor starts as two
phase induction motor.suppply given to two phases will
produce rotating magnetic fields so the motor becomes self
starting.
